Output 66b95c349f04189768412663dd2d0524b9913304e0263da04f22816c50faf97d:1

value
4218275
script pubkey
OP_0 OP_PUSHBYTES_20 f9e2dccaeecfb771982f5aba9a65957dcd09a95e
address
ltc1ql83dejhwe7mhrxp0t2af5ev40hxsn227u72awj
transaction
66b95c349f04189768412663dd2d0524b9913304e0263da04f22816c50faf97d
spent
true